I met a Nigel, a few days ago at pizza hut...he was driving a 2001 Range Rover in the same color as my D2. I spotted him and we started talking about Land Rover. He mentioned that on an actual DVD of Camel Trophy, there is commentary from Land Rover that they are practically stock with the acception of the obvious things you see, like a winch and more water resistant interior and I suppose tires. Plus all the things like shovels lights axes and jacks and such.
